Transaction d78d96ceba7ae25114d47e1388ceee80157c7380586c3692361bc039c2505820
1 Input
1 Output
-
d78d96ceba7ae25114d47e1388ceee80157c7380586c3692361bc039c2505820:0
- value
- 1999985363
- script pubkey
- OP_0 OP_PUSHBYTES_20 e83765adf219da46513441b6e4d8985e25d3ad18
- address
- bc1qaqmktt0jr8dyv5f5gxmwfkyctcja8tgcw446f0